A good way to start with a cell phone is with the pay as you go phones. I have a TracFone, myself. They start in a price range of like under $10 so the expense would be low if your dad's afraid that you'll be careless and lose it. You BUY airtime and minutes. So, your dad could keep tabs on your spending on calls by only buying you a certain amount of minutes. You aren't allowed to let your minutes completely run out or go passed the date that your bought air time expires though so you do have to keep a watch on that. That information shows right on the face of your phone so it's easy to watch.
